<blockquote data-quote="Horoscope Fish" data-source="post: 188108" data-attributes="member: 13090"><p>Your third shot, I think, is your strongest image of the three. I would like it even more if I could see the tops of the concrete posts, and with a little more space on the far right of the image. You have a strong leading line and too little space for my eye to fall into. Still, I like that you converted it to B&W and the long exposure gives the water an entirely appropriate ethereal quality.</p></blockquote><p></p>
